Yes, you can travel by bus from Thailand to Cambodia. One of the most popular routes connects Bangkok in Thailand to Siem Reap in Cambodia. These two cities are approximately 410 km apart, which translates to an 8-10 hour bus ride.
Prices for buses from Bangkok to Cambodia range from 23 to 39 euros. Several companies operate on this route, so the price can vary depending on the carrier you choose.
